| sculpt [ skulpt ] (past and past participle sculpt·ed, present participle sculpt·ing, 3rd person present singular sculpts) |
verb |
|
| Definition: |
| |
1. transitive and intransitive verb make sculpture: to carve, model, cast, or otherwise create a three-dimensional representation of something as a work of art
|
2. transitive verb carve or model material: to use a material in sculpting
|
3. intransitive verb be sculptor: to create three-dimensional works of art as a profession or pastime
|
4. transitive verb shape something naturally: to change the shape or contours of something by natural processes such as erosion
|
| [Mid-19th century. < French sculpter< sculpteur "sculptor" < Latin sculpt- (see sculpture)] |
